:2026-04-05 17:30 点击:1
在Web3生态中,合约交互交易是连接用户与去中心化应用(DApp)的核心纽带,也是区块链技术实现价值自动流转的关键载体,不同于Web2的中心化服务依赖后台系统处理数据,Web3的智能合约以代码形式预设规则,通过交易触发执行,在无需信任第三方的前提下,完成资产转移、数据更新、权限管理等复杂操作,构建了“代码即法律”的自动化协作范式。
合约交互的本质是用户向区块链网络发送一笔包含特定指令的交易,目标指向智能合约的地址,以以太坊为例,当用户与DeFi协议交互(如添加流动性、借贷还款)时,需在交易中明确调用合约的函数(如addLiquidity、repay),并附上必要的参数(如代币数量、滑点阈值),交易经节点广播后,由矿工/验证者打包进区块,通过EVM(以太坊虚拟机)解析执行,最终修改链上状态——这个过程既涉及密码学签名验证用户身份,依赖Gas费机制补偿网络计算资源,也通过共识算法确保所有节点对状态变更达成一致,实现了“交易可验证、状态不可篡改”的信任基础。
合约交互的应用已从早期的DeFi扩展至全Web3生态,在DeFi领域,用户通过调用Uniswap的swap函数完成代币兑换,或通过Aave的deposit函数将资产存入生息池,每一笔交易都是合约条款的自动执行;

尽管合约交互是Web3的基石,但其仍面临Gas费波动、操作门槛高、安全风险等挑战,随着Layer2扩容方案(如Optimism、Arbitrum)通过rollup技术降低交易成本,以及抽象账户(ERC-4337)实现 gas abstraction(用户无需手动支付ETH Gas),普通用户无需持有原生代币即可完成交互,极大降低了使用门槛,安全审计工具(如Slither、MythX)的普及和形式化验证技术的应用,正逐步减少合约漏洞导致的资产损失风险,让交互更可靠。
从技术原理到生态应用,Web3合约交互交易不仅是区块链价值的“传输管道”,更是重构生产关系的底层协议,随着技术迭代与用户体验优化,这一机制将进一步渗透至金融、社交、物联网等领域,推动数字经济向“去中心化、自动化、可信任”的未来演进。
本文由用户投稿上传,若侵权请提供版权资料并联系删除!